Due to her role in the recent season of American Horror Story — look at the monster you’ve created, Ryan Murphy! — Kim Kardashian appeared on the latest season of Variety‘s “Actors on Actors” series alongside veteran actress Chloe Sevigny.

In typical Kim Kardashian fashion, the 43-year-old social media influencer made a wildly tone-deaf comment while reminiscing about the glory days of Beverely Hills.

Speaking about the 1989 film Troop Beverly Hills, Kardashian — striking a nostalgic tone — bemoaned the fact that you can no longer “drive down in a Rolls Royce in Beverly Hills these days, you know, all the shopping bags out, you’d get robbed.”

One of the most viral responses to the video, which has over 1.6 million views, says that Kardashian has no “couth, self-awareness or range.”

Another common response was to feel sorry for Sevigny having to be put through this, as she’s an Academy Award-nominated actress who has been in the business for decades and takes her work far more seriously than being put in a room with Kardashian deserves.

Many also joked that Sevigny deserves even further acclaim and awards for acting like she was interested in anything Kardashian was saying.

“Chloe deserves several Pscars for acting like this conversation was even minimally interesting,” said a viral post.

Sevigny, who made her acting debut in the 1995 film Kids, was appearing on Variety’s Actors on Actors series to promote her new FX series Feud: Capote Vs. The Swans, which was also created by Ryan Murphy.

Sevigny has worked with Murphy in the past as she starred in both American Horror Story: Asylum in 2012 (the best season of the series) and American Horror Story: Hotel in 2015.

Prior to starring American Horror Story: Delicate, Kardashian had only made cameos as herself and starred in reality television. Murphy is also making her the lead of another upcoming series that’ll see her star as the owner of an all-female law firm.
